前端

nginx部署前端教程

Nginx 部署前端教程Nginx 是一款高性能的 web 服务器,广泛用于静态文件服务及反向代理。通过 Nginx 部署前端项目,可以高效地提供静态资源,让用户更快地访问网站。本文将通过一个简单的实例,向您介绍如何使用 Nginx 部署前端项目。准备工作在开始之前,请确保您的服务器上已经安装

【Golang】Go语言Web开发之模板渲染

Go语言Web开发之模板渲染在Go语言的Web开发中,模板渲染是一个非常重要的部分。它通常用于将动态数据插入到静态页面中,以便生成用户友好的Web界面。在Go中,标准库提供了强大的模板处理功能,使得我们能够轻松地生成HTML页面。模板的基本概念Go语言的模板系统提供了text/template

前端:Element UI 与 Vuetify 的选择

在现代前端开发中,选择合适的 UI 组件库对提升开发效率和用户体验至关重要。Element UI 和 Vuetify 是两个备受欢迎的 Vue.js UI 框架,它们各有特点,使得开发者在选择时常常感到困惑。本文将对这两个库进行比较,帮助你做出更好的选择。Element UIElement UI

JavaScript基础-函数(完整版)

JavaScript基础-函数(完整版)在JavaScript中,函数是一个非常重要的概念,它是封装一组操作的代码块,可以重复执行,提升代码的重用性和可读性。理解函数的定义、调用以及作用域等是掌握JavaScript的基础。本文将详细介绍JavaScript中的函数,并给出相应的代码示例。1.

【实战】一、Jest 前端自动化测试框架基础入门(二) —— 前端要学的测试课 从Jest入门到TDD BDD双实战(二)

Jest 前端自动化测试框架基础入门(二)在前一篇文章中,我们简要介绍了Jest测试框架的基本概念和设置流程。Jest是一个强大的JavaScript测试框架,广泛用于测试React应用程序。不过,Jest不仅仅适用于React,它还可以测试任何JavaScript代码。本文将深入探讨如何使用Je

vite解决前端跨域步骤

在现代前端开发中,跨域问题是一种常见的挑战。为了避免这种问题,开发者通常需要采取一些措施。Vite 作为一个现代前端构建工具,它提供了一些简单易用的方法来解决跨域问题。本文将详细介绍如何通过 Vite 配置解决前端的跨域请求。一、什么是跨域?跨域是指在一个网站上请求另一个网站的资源,通常不同的协

xss漏洞(五,xss-labs靶场搭建及简单讲解)

XSS漏洞(五):XSS-Labs靶场搭建及简单讲解跨站脚本攻击(XSS)是一种常见的网络安全漏洞,攻击者能够在用户的浏览器中注入恶意脚本,进而窃取用户的Cookie信息、会话令牌,或者进行其他恶意操作。为了帮助学习和理解XSS攻击的原理,搭建一个XSS-Labs靶场是非常有必要的。本文将介绍如何

前端vue2与后端接口的简单联调步骤

在现代 web 开发中,前端与后端的联调是一个重要的环节。这里以 Vue 2 为前端框架,并结合一个简单的后端接口,实现简单的联调。本文将详细介绍联调步骤,并给出相关代码示例。一、环境准备在开始联调之前,我们需要确保开发环境已准备好。前端需要安装 Node.js 和 Vue CLI,后端可以使用

JavaScript 字符串处理:trim()和replace()

在JavaScript中,字符串是一个重要的数据类型,常常用于处理和显示文本信息。在字符串处理中,我们经常需要对字符串进行一些操作,比如去除多余的空格、替换特定的字符或模式等。JavaScript提供了许多内置的方法来帮助开发者完成这些任务,其中trim()和replace()是两个非常常用的方法。

streamlit:如何快速构建一个应用,不会前端也能写出好看的界面

Streamlit 是一个开源的 Python 库,旨在帮助开发者以简单的方式构建漂亮的 web 应用,即便是没有前端开发经验的人也能轻松上手。通过Streamlit,你可以用几行代码快速构建一个交互式的数据应用展示工具,尤其是在数据科学和机器学习领域。下面,我们将详细介绍如何使用 Streamli